Case Western Reserve University Research Assistant 1 in Cleveland, Ohio

POSITION OBJECTIVE

Working under moderate supervision, the Research Assistant 1 will perform research work in medical and related technical areas involving the use of laboratory and research skills. The research assistant will primarily be responsible for running cell cultures and working with animal models of disease. These duties will be performed in the lab to investigate the cellular and molecular mechanisms that govern cancer cell plasticity and growth. This position will work with animals.

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S

  1. Perform research work, generate and conduct analysis of samples on specific mouse cancer cell function in vitro and in vivo. Work with animal models of disease, including xenografts modeling cancer; this includes genotyping appropriate handling of mice and measuring xenograft tumors with calipers. In vitro work will include standard tissue culture technique such as passaging cells and counting cells and harvesting RNA and protein from cells in culture for qPCR and western blotting. (65%)
  2. Record results of experiments and maintain experimental records in Lab Archives, a provided online electronic lab notebook. (10%)
  3. Monitor and maintain test equipment utilized in experiments to ensure that it is clean and fully functional. Report to senior lab personnel any equipment malfunction. (10%)
  4. Monitor laboratory supplies necessary for completion of experiments, order depleted supplies using in house ordering system and restock newly ordered supplies as they arrive. (10%)
